Xu Shi is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Pathology and Forensic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Xu Shi has authored 31 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Molecular Biology, 7 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and 5 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ine. Recurrent topics in Xu Shi's work include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(9 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(4 papers) and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ers). Xu Shi is often cited by papers focused on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(9 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(4 papers) and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ers). Xu Shi coll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and United Kingdom. Xu Shi's co-authors include Robert E. Gerszten, Hasmik Keshishian, Marc S. Sabatine, Steven A. Carr, D.R. Mani, Michael Burgess, Terri A. Addona, Laurie Farrell, Eric Kuhn and Dongxiao Shen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Circulation and Nature Communications.
